The forecast for fresh spotted flounder production in capture fisheries in Italy shows a consistent year-on-year increase from 2024 to 2028, with values rising from 5.02 to 5.51 thousand euros per metric ton. This upward trend represents an average annual growth rate of approximately 2.4% over this period. In 2023, the value stood at a lower estimate compared to the forecast for 2024, indicating positive growth momentum in the market.
